Mullet, Mayor Department of Public Works James x' Morrow, RE, Director SPECIAL CONDITIONS OWEST - STREET USE PERMIT Revised 9 /25/00 This Street Use Permit is valid for 180 calendar days from the date of issuance. Nothing in this agreement shall relieve Permitee from any obligation to obtain approvals or necessary permits from applicable federal, state and City authorities for all activities in the Permit area. 1. Claims & Damages — In the construction, installation, repair, operation or maintenance of its structures and facilities, as covered by this Permit, the Permitee shall use reasonable and appropriate precautions to avoid damage to persons or property. Permitee shall indemnify and save harmless the City from all claims, actions or damages of every kind or description, including reasonable attorney's and expert witness fees, which may accrue to or be suffered by any person or persons, corporation or property to the extent caused in part or in whole by any negligent act or omission of Permitee, its officers, agents, servants or employees, carried on in the furtherance of the rights, benefits and privileges granted under this Permit. In the event any claim or demand is presented to or filed with the City which gives rise to Permitee's obligation pursuant to this section, the City shall within a reasonable time notify Permitee thereof and Permitee shall have a right, at its election, to settle or compromise such claim or demand. In the event any claim or action is commenced in which the City is named a party, and which suit or action is based on a claim or demand which gives rise to Permitee's obligation pursuant to this Permit, the City shall promptly notify Permitee thereof, and Permitee shall, at its sole coat and expense, defend such suit or action by attorneys of its own election. In defense of such suit or action, Permitee may, at its election and at its sole cost and expense, settle or compromise such suit or action. This section shall not be construed to require Permitee to: a) protect and save the City harmless from any claims, actions or damages; b) settle or compromise any claim, demand, suit or action; c) appear in or defend any suit or action; or, d) pay any judgment or reimburse the City's costs and expenses (including reasonable attorney's fees), to the extent such claim arises out of the sole negligence of the City. To the extent of any concurrent negligence between Permitee and the City, Permitee's obligations under this paragraph shall only extend to its share of negligence or fault. The City shall have the right at all times to participate through its own attorney in any suit or action which arises out of any right, privilege and authority granted by or exercised pursuant to this Permit when the City determines that such participation is required to protect the interests of the City or the public. Such participation by the City shall be at the City's sole cost and expense. 2. n u a ce - Permitee shall maintain liability insurance written on a per occurrence basis during the full term of this Permit for personal injuries and property damages. The policy shall name the City of Tukwila as additionally insured and shall contain coverage in the following minimum amounts per separate occurrence: Personal Injury: Property Damage: Not less than 81,000,000.00 per occurrence combined single limit Not less than $1,000,000.00 per occurrence combined single limit Such Insurance policy shall also contain a policy provision that it cannot be revoked, canceled or reduced without sixty (60) days advance written notice to the City, and Permittee shall annually provide proof of such insurance to the City Clerk's Office. 3. Coordinate - All work by Permitee within the Permit area shall be coordinated with the Engineering Division of the Public Works Department to ensure consistency with future City of Tukwila Capital Improvement Projects and shall not commence without 24 hours advance notice to the City's Utility inspector, Greg Villanueva, at (206) 433.0178. 4. Construction Standards - Any construction, installation, maintenance and restoration activities performed by or for Permitee within the Permit area shall bo conducted and located so as to produce the least amount of interference with the free passage of pedestrian and vehicular traffic. All construction, installation; maintenance and restoration activities shall be conducted such that they conform to the most current City of Tukwila standards in effect at the time that such activities take place. 5. Underaround stallation Required - All telecommunication cables and junction boxes or other vaulted system components shall be installed underground in accordance with the utilities undergrounding ordinance requirements (Tukwila Municipal Code - Chapter 13.08) which are in effect at the time of the construction authorized under the attached Permit, in the event that the undergrounding requirements are deferred for any new or upgrade construction or installation of wire or associated facilities, Permitee agrees by their signature and acceptance of this permit, to participate in the proportionate share of the underground trenching costs and underground conversion costs for any portion of the route taken by the work authorized in this Permit at such time in the future that the City constructs street improvements which include conversion of existing overhead utilities to underground. 6. Relocation - Whenever the City determines that it is necessary for any of Permitee's facilities or other system components to be moved or relocated to accommodate the maintenance, construction or enhancement of any public amenity in the Permit area, the City shall notify Permitee in writing of such determination, and Permitee shall promptly submit plans for such relocation. Within ninety (90) days of the approval by the City of the plans for relocation, Permitee shall relocate those facilities or structures designated by the City. AD costs of moving or relocating such facilities or structures, including but not limited to costs for design, engineering and construction, shall be the sole responsibility of Permitee. 7. Removal QT andonmer - Upon the removal from service of any transmission lines or other associated structures, facilities and amenities, Permitee shall comply with all applicable standards and requirements prescribed by the City of Tukwila Public Works Department for the removal or abandonment of said structures and transmission facilities. 8. performance Bond - The Public Works Director for the City of Tukwila reserves the right to require Permitee to obtain a performance bond for any work which the Director deems to pose a threat to any property or to public safety. Such bond shell be issued by a company licensed by proper authority of the State of Washington and shall be filed with the City Clerk's Office until release is authorized by the Public Works Director, 9. "One•Call" Location & Llabiiity - Permitee shall subscribe to and maintain membership In the regional "One- Call" utility location service and shall promptly locate all of Its lines upon request. The City shall not be liable for any damages to Permitee system components or for Interruptions in service to Permitee customers which are a direct result of work performed for any City project for which Permitee has failed to properly locate Its lines and facilities within the prescribed time limits and guidelines established by One Cali. The City shall also not be liable for any damages to Permitee's system components or for interruptions in service to Permitee's customers resulting from work performed under any other Permit issued by the City. 10. City vlded Conduit - In those areas of the City where the City has installed its own conduit, Permitee shall utilize such conduit under separate lease agreement with the City. Such agreement shall be negotiated as to the specific terms and the lease shall be provided at a reasonable rate. 11. Tra, fl Coat - Detours within the City's right -of -way shall be in accordance with the current edition of the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ices. A traffic control plan shall be submitted for prior approval if requested by the City's Utility Inspector. 12. Open Cuts, - For work within an improved public street, no open cuts shall be allowed unless specifically approved. 13. A9 -Built Records -- Permitee shall provide the City with As -Built drawings depicting line and grade for all structures and facilities installed under this permit, Such As- Builts shall be in a form acceptable to the City and approved by the City prior to closure and sign -off of this Permit. 14. Permit Compliance, — The failure by Permitee to comply fully with any of the provisions of this Permit may result in a written notice from the City which describes the violations of the Permit and requests remedial action within thirty (30) days of receipt of such notice. If Permitee has not attained full compliance at the end of the thirty (30) day period following receipt of the violation notification, the City may declare an immediate termination of all Permit rights and privileges. The demonstration of due diligence on the part of the Permitee may be grounds for the grant of an extension in the period during which compliance is to be attained; provided that, Permitee continues to pursue correction of any violations of the Permit noted by the City. 15. Emeraericv Actions — If any of Permitee's actions or any failure by Permitee to act to correct a situation is deemed by the City to create a threat to life or property, the City may order Permitee to immediately correct said situation or, at the City's discretion, the City may undertake measures to correct said situation itself. Permitee shall be liable for all costs, expenses, and damages attributable to the correction of such an emergency situation as undertaken by the City and shall further be liable for all costs, expenses and damages resulting from such situation. Any reimbursement of such costs to the City shall be made within thirty (30) days of the completion of such action or determination of damages by the City. The failure by Permitee to correct a situation identified by the City as a threat to public or private safety or property shall be considered a violation of Permit terms and each day that such a situation continues to exist shall be regarded as a separate violation, 16.
